Legendary Malaysian artist Jalil Hamid dies at 69 after decades of film and music

Malaysian singer and actor Jalil Hamid has died at the age of 69. He passed away peacefully in his sleep at 12:30pm on May 4, 2023. Known for his work in film and music, Jalil left behind a legacy spanning over four decades in the entertainment industry. Jalil began his career in the early 1980s, becoming a familiar face in Malaysian cinema and music. He starred in well-known films such as Baginda (1997), Zombi Kampung Pisang (2007), Lelaki Harapan Dunia (2014), and Bisik Pada Langit (2017). His performances earned him accolades, including Best Supporting Actor for Baginda at the 13th Malaysia Film Festival and Best Supporting Actor (Drama) for Calon Syurga at the 2016 Anugerah Skrin.

Beyond acting, Jalil was also recognised for his music. Songs like *Ayam*, *Raya*, and *Makan* became popular among fans over the years. In July 2022, Jalil underwent surgery and was later diagnosed with an enlarged heart. His health struggles led to significant weight loss—around 30 kg—and a loss of appetite. However, by 2024, he had shared that his condition was improving, allowing him to eat more substantial meals again. After his passing, Jalil’s body was taken to Masjid Al-Munawwarah in Shah Alam, Selangor. He will be laid to rest at the Section 21 Shah Alam Muslim Cemetery following the Asar prayers.

Jalil Hamid’s death marks the end of a long and influential career in Malaysian entertainment. His contributions to film and music will be remembered by audiences and colleagues alike. The burial will take place later today in Shah Alam.
